If you see wiring or a keypad, the cheaper course is usually a certified technician.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Practical markers of a fair locksmith estimate and what to avoid.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; High-pressure sales, hourly ambiguities, or demands for an unusual payment method are warning signs. A reasonable quote lists travel fee, labor, and parts separately and explains each step the technician will take. An insured locksmith with references will usually charge a fair market rate and stand behind the work.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://locksmithunit.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/06/locksmith.mp4&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Which questions to ask a locksmith to keep the price honest.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; No question is a waste when money is on the line; ask about exact fees and tools needed. Ask if the quote includes a warranty or a return visit if the lock sticks. A transparent pro will spell out every charge without hesitation.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Practical tech tricks and local resources that reduce locksmith costs.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Before you call, search for local reviews and recent photos so you can avoid high-pressure storefronts and suspicious listings. Mobile locksmiths sometimes have lower overhead and fairer on-the-spot pricing than storefronts. Use neighborhood groups or your apartment manager to find pre-approved vendors, which often have negotiated, lower rates than random services.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How to check if your policy or membership covers lockouts and what to expect.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Your auto insurance or AAA-like membership might include lockout coverage that is cheaper than calling a locksmith directly. If you call your insurer, ask if they dispatch a preferred vendor and whether you can choose an alternative if the preferred one is overpriced. Knowing coverage details prevents surprises on the final bill.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Paying strategically and rejecting unnecessary work that inflates the bill.&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Card payments or reputable payment apps give a paper trail you can contest if needed. Replacement is sometimes necessary, but often a rekey or minor repair will do and cost much less.
